Comprehensive Definitions & Senses
2 senses- 1
The underlying layer of vegetation in a forest, especially the plants growing beneath the forest canopy and above the ground cover.
"A diverse array of shade-tolerant ferns and saplings thrived in the damp understory of the old-growth forest." - 2
An underlying or subordinate layer of something, metaphorical or literal.
"The novel explores the complex understory of family secrets and unspoken tensions."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
The word is formed by combining the English prefix 'under-' with 'story', which historically referred to a floor or level of a building (derived from Old French 'estorie' and Latin 'historia'). By the 19th century, the term was adopted into ecological nomenclature to describe the vegetative layer beneath the main canopy of a forest.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
